Description

AnaptysBio is a clinical-stage biotechnology company developing therapeutic antibody candidates for inflammatory and immuno-oncology indications. Its pipeline includes programs directed at interleukin-36 receptor, modulators of PD-1 signaling, and BTLA, with assets progressing through preclinical and clinical milestones. The company maintains collaborations and licensing arrangements with major industry and research partners, and is headquartered in San Diego, California; it was incorporated in 2005.
